Steve Emerson, a renowned actor of considerable talent, came into this world on October 31, 1934, in the charming borough of Lambeth, situated within the vibrant city of London, England, United Kingdom.
His illustrious career has been marked by a plethora of notable roles, including a memorable appearance in the cult classic Shaun of the Dead, released in 2004, where he left an indelible mark on audiences worldwide.
Moreover, his impressive repertoire also boasts a starring turn in the grandiose The Phantom of the Opera, another 2004 release, which showcased his remarkable range and versatility as a thespian.
Furthermore, his extensive filmography also includes a significant role in the beloved fantasy epic Willow, which premiered in 1988, cementing his status as a talented and respected figure in the world of cinema.
